Titusville, Florida — A sweeping law enforcement crackdown across four Florida counties led to the seizure of more than 500 illegal gambling machines operating inside restaurants, nail salons, gas stations and so-called “sham arcades,” officials announced.
The large-scale operation targeted 39 separate locations in Volusia, Brevard, Duval and Flagler counties, according to the Florida Attorney General’s Office.
525 Machines Confiscated Across 39 Locations
Authorities said they confiscated 525 illegal gambling machines, describing the network as a sophisticated underground operation disguised as legitimate businesses.
